
要让Excel框变成红色,你可以使用条件格式、填充颜色、VBA宏。这些方法可以帮助你在不同情况下对单元格进行颜色调整。以下是详细的步骤和方法。
一、条件格式
条件格式是一种强大的功能,可以根据单元格的内容自动更改其格式,包括颜色。
1. 创建基本条件格式
- 选择单元格范围:选中你想要应用条件格式的单元格或区域。
- 打开条件格式:在Excel的“开始”选项卡中,点击“条件格式”。
- 新建规则:选择“新建规则”。
- 选择规则类型:选择“使用公式确定要设置格式的单元格”。
- 输入公式:在公式框中输入你的条件,例如
=A1>100,表示当A1单元格的值大于100时,格式会改变。 - 设置格式:点击“格式”,在“填充”选项卡中选择红色,然后点击“确定”。
- 应用规则:点击“确定”完成设置。
2. 应用复杂条件
你可以根据多个条件设置更复杂的格式。例如,设定多个条件以便根据不同的值或状态更改单元格颜色。
- 选择单元格范围:选中你想要应用条件格式的单元格或区域。
- 打开条件格式:在Excel的“开始”选项卡中,点击“条件格式”。
- 管理规则:选择“管理规则”,然后点击“新建规则”。
- 选择规则类型:选择“使用公式确定要设置格式的单元格”。
- 输入多个公式:例如你可以输入
=AND(A1>50, A1<=100),表示当A1的值大于50且小于等于100时,格式会改变。 - 设置格式:点击“格式”,在“填充”选项卡中选择红色,然后点击“确定”。
- 重复步骤:根据需要重复添加多个条件和格式。
二、填充颜色
如果你只想手动更改单元格的颜色,可以使用填充颜色功能。
1. 手动填充颜色
- 选择单元格:选中你想要填充颜色的单元格。
- 打开填充颜色选项:在Excel的“开始”选项卡中,找到“填充颜色”按钮,点击下拉菜单。
- 选择颜色:选择红色,单元格的背景颜色会立即变为红色。
2. 批量填充颜色
- 选择单元格范围:选中你想要填充颜色的多个单元格或区域。
- 打开填充颜色选项:在Excel的“开始”选项卡中,找到“填充颜色”按钮,点击下拉菜单。
- 选择颜色:选择红色,所有选中的单元格背景颜色会立即变为红色。
三、VBA宏
对于更复杂的需求,你可以使用VBA(Visual Basic for Applications)宏来自动更改单元格颜色。
1. 创建基本VBA宏
- 打开VBA编辑器:按
Alt + F11打开VBA编辑器。 - 插入模块:在VBA编辑器中,点击“插入”菜单,选择“模块”。
- 编写代码:在新模块中输入以下代码:
Sub ChangeColor()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ets("Sheet1")
Dim rng As Range
Set rng = ws.Range("A1:A10") ' 修改为你的范围
Dim cell As Range
For Each cell In rng
If cell.Value > 100 Then ' 修改为你的条件
cell.Interior.Color = RGB(255, 0, 0) ' 红色
End If
Next cell
End Sub
- 运行宏:按
F5或者点击“运行”按钮执行宏。
2. 高级VBA宏
你可以根据需要编写更复杂的VBA宏来处理不同的条件和范围。
- 打开VBA编辑器:按
Alt + F11打开VBA编辑器。 - 插入模块:在VBA编辑器中,点击“插入”菜单,选择“模块”。
- 编写代码:在新模块中输入以下代码:
Sub AdvancedChangeColor()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ets("Sheet1")
Dim rng As Range
Set rng = ws.Range("A1:A10") ' 修改为你的范围
Dim cell As Range
For Each cell In rng
If cell.Value > 100 Then
cell.Interior.Color = RGB(255, 0, 0) ' 红色
ElseIf cell.Value > 50 Then
cell.Interior.Color = RGB(255, 255, 0) ' 黄色
Else
cell.Interior.Color = RGB(0, 255, 0) ' 绿色
End If
Next cell
End Sub
- 运行宏:按
F5或者点击“运行”按钮执行宏。
通过以上方法,你可以灵活地根据需要更改Excel单元格的颜色。根据具体需求选择最适合的方法,不同的方法适用于不同的场景和需求。
相关问答FAQs:
1. 为什么我的Excel框没有变成红色?
Excel框的颜色通常是根据条件格式设置的,可能是您没有正确设置条件或者没有应用到所需的单元格范围上。
2. 如何将Excel框变成红色?
要将Excel框变成红色,您可以使用条件格式功能。首先,选择您想要应用条件格式的单元格或单元格范围。然后,打开“开始”选项卡,点击“条件格式”按钮,选择“新建规则”,在规则类型中选择“使用公式确定要设置的单元格”,在公式框中输入条件,例如“=A1>100”表示当A1单元格的值大于100时应用格式。接下来,点击“格式”按钮,选择“填充”选项卡,选择红色作为背景色,点击“确定”按钮应用条件格式。
3. 如何取消Excel框的红色背景色?
如果您想取消Excel框的红色背景色,可以通过清除条件格式来实现。选择含有红色背景色的单元格范围,点击“开始”选项卡中的“条件格式”按钮,选择“清除规则”,然后选择“清除规则”按钮。这样就可以将所有的条件格式都清除,包括红色背景色。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4304033